2. XMPie
XMPie, from Xerox, is a well-established player in the VDP software market, known for its comprehensive suite of tools aimed at creating personalized marketing campaigns. The platform offers powerful design capabilities and robust integration with Xerox's own printing hardware, though it's compatible with other devices as well. XMPie's strength lies in its ability to handle complex VDP projects, from simple mailers to intricate multi-channel campaigns. Its user-friendly interface makes it accessible for designers and marketing professionals.
- Description: XMPie offers a robust suite of VDP software solutions designed for creating personalized marketing communications across print and digital channels.
- Pros:
- Strong integration with Xerox hardware.
- Flexible design capabilities for various VDP needs.
- Supports multi-channel marketing campaigns.
- Good for complex personalization requirements.
- Cons:
- Can be resource-intensive.
- Best performance often linked with Xerox equipment.
- User interface, while generally good, can feel dated to some users.
- Who it's best for: Businesses already invested in Xerox technology, marketing departments looking for integrated print and digital personalization, and print shops with diverse client needs.
3. Objectif Lune
Objectif Lune is another significant contender in the VDP software space, offering solutions that focus on document composition and automation. Their products are geared towards creating dynamic documents, forms, and marketing materials with a strong emphasis on efficient workflow management. Objectif Lune's solutions are often praised for their ability to handle transactional documents as well as high-impact marketing pieces, making them versatile for various industries.
- Description: Objectif Lune provides powerful document composition and workflow automation software, enabling businesses to create personalized and dynamic print and digital documents.
- Pros:
- Excellent for automating production workflows.
- Handles both transactional and marketing VDP well.
- Good for batch processing and complex document assembly.
- Scalable solutions available.
- Cons:
- The learning curve can be significant for mastering all features.
- Interface can sometimes feel less intuitive than newer competitors.
- Who it's best for: Organizations focused on high-volume document production, transactional printing, and businesses looking to automate their entire document lifecycle.

9. PitStop Pro / Server (Enfocus)
While primarily known as a PDF preflight and editing tool, Enfocus PitStop Pro and its server counterpart offer powerful capabilities for VDP, especially when used in conjunction with other VDP engines or workflows. PitStop Server can automate many VDP tasks, including batch processing, data merging, and adding variable elements, making it a valuable component in a sophisticated VDP workflow.
- Description: Enfocus PitStop Pro and PitStop Server offer automation capabilities that can be leveraged for VDP tasks, including preflighting, data transformations, and batch processing.
- Pros:
- Excellent for PDF automation and quality control.
- Can integrate with existing VDP workflows to add automated features.
- Powerful for batch processing and data manipulation.
- Cons:
- Not a standalone VDP design tool; often requires other software.
- Can have a steep learning curve and is geared towards technical users.
- Who it's best for: Print service providers and prepress departments looking to enhance existing VDP workflows with powerful PDF automation and quality assurance.
10. Caldera VisualRIP+ VDP
Caldera VisualRIP+ is well-known in the wide-format printing industry. Its VDP module allows for personalization of wide-format graphics, banners, and signage. This makes it a niche but powerful solution for businesses operating in this sector that need to offer custom graphics with variable data elements, such as personalized event banners or custom retail displays.
- Description: Caldera VisualRIP+ VDP is a solution tailored for the wide-format printing industry, enabling personalization of graphics with variable data.
- Pros:
- Specifically designed for wide-format printing needs.
- User-friendly interface for this specific market.
- Integrates VDP into a robust RIP workflow.
- Cons:
- Limited application outside of wide-format printing.
- Less suitable for standard commercial or transactional printing.
- Who it's best for: Wide-format print shops and businesses that require personalized graphics for large-format applications.

What should I look for in VDP software in 2026 for advanced personalization?
In 2026, for advanced personalization, look for VDP software that offers dynamic content rules, conditional logic, integration with customer data platforms (CDPs), robust API support for custom integrations, and the ability to personalize richer media formats beyond basic print.

How does VDP software contribute to marketing ROI?
VDP software contributes to marketing ROI by enabling highly targeted and personalized campaigns, which typically result in higher customer engagement, better conversion rates, and reduced waste compared to generic mass mailings. Accurate data merging also minimizes errors and associated costs.
